1525 in France
Events from the year 1525 in France.
Incumbents
Events
- February 24 -The French army is defeated in the Battle of Pavia, this was the decisive engagement of the Italian War of 1521–26.
- August 30 - Treaty of the More was signed between Henry VIII of England and queen regent Louise of Savoy restoring relation between France and England.
